JKS Front Track Bar Brace Questions
 
So I am thinking of getting the JKS front track bar brace. I am wondering a few things..

I see it comes with its own sleeve bushing, what is that for?

Do it mount the track bar through the same OEM holes, or does it move it up higher?

yoshillopez May 15, 2009 12:07 AM

The JKS track bar brace allows you to mount the track bar in the stock location or re-locate if you have a high steering conversion. The sleeve bushing is used when you re-locate the track bar. The only issue I had was with the steering stabilizer. If you use the position the track bar brace provides, you are going to need a stabilizer with spherical bushings. However, Gokracer1 showed me a way to use the Teraflex HD stabilizer utilizing the Woods re-location bracket. Let me know if you want some pics of it installed. I also have the install instructions I can send you. Just PM your e-mail address.

Originally Posted by greenamphibious (Post 1125414)
on the JKS site it says for lifts 3" and up... :thinking: no issues running it with your OME kit?

No issues at all. With lifts 3" and lower when you are not running a high steer conversion, just use the stock location. The JKS brace has two mounting points...stock location and a relocated position.
